      I don't like bitter coffee either, I use a French Press and after my water boils I let it sit for 30 to 60 seconds so it's not boiling hot, the hotter the water the more bitter the coffee. I also only steep my coffee for 3.5 minutes. It's trial and error figure out how much coffee to use and which temperature water works best for you and how long to steep but once you figure it out you're golden. I like to add milk and caramel and sometimes cinnamon, almond extract, chocolate, nutmeg, anise whatever I'm in the mood for.

      If you dislike bitterness, I would recommend changing the roast from dark or medium dark to medium roast. Still bitter, then change the size of coffee grounds to more coarse or brew it in such a way that underextracts the coffee (use filter paper method or if using a method which leaves the coffee in water, decrease the time coffee sits in the water). Lastly, drink it at warm temperature and not hot. Also give it a chance to develope it's taste, like don't gulp the coffee, take small sips and drink it slowly.

    I first started doing cold brew in my Ikea french press (hey, it was cheap, it works, and the plunger comes apart for easy cleaning). Until my wife discovered that she also likes cold brew and the french press wouldn't make enough for the two of us. So, I ended up getting one of those 1 gallon cold brew kits (glass bottle with a spout at the bottom and a perforated metal insert that hangs into the water from the top) from Amazon. Works really well and it is our summer brew. The gallon usually lasts the two of us 4-5 days.
    One thing that I've discovered, which might be an interesting topic to unpack for a future video, is some coffees really don't work well as cold brew. I get some really nice, nuanced beans as a monthly delivery from a local roaster. The beans are usually closer to a medium roast, and have really complex flavors when brewed through my regular drip coffee maker. But, the few times I've tried making cold brew with them, the flavor profile turns super floral. Kinda feels like grazing at the local florists... Not really my cup of coffee... So the video idea might be on how hot brew tastes differently from cold brew with the same beans.

      Hey there! It might just be arguing semantics, but in the coffee community, a latte needs to have actual espresso in it to qualify. Moka pots, while great, technically can't create true espresso - just strong coffee. People often have the same confusion surrounding the aeropress. A large part of espresso creation is the pressure that is only possible in espresso machines, automatic or manual pressing. I myself have made plenty of cafe au lait with my Moka pot and would recommend them to anyone who doesn't have access to an espresso machine, though!
